What is the Hadesbet Accumulator Bet Boost Feature?

The Hadesbet Accumulator Bet Boost is a promotional tool designed to enhance the potential returns on your multi-leg sports bets. In simple terms, an accumulator (or “acca”) is a single bet that links together two or more individual selections. The attraction is a much higher potential payout, as the odds for each selection are multiplied. However, the risk is also higher because if just one selection loses, the entire bet loses. The accumulator bet boost at Hadesbet directly addresses this risk by increasing the combined odds of your winning acca, giving you extra winnings on top. Common Issues and Troubleshooting

Users sometimes encounter problems when trying to use the accumulator boost. Here are the most frequent issues and their solutions:

  • “Boost option not appearing”: This usually means your bet does not meet the criteria. Check the number of selections, the minimum odds, and ensure all selections are from eligible markets.
  • Boost applied but winnings incorrect: If you win but the payout seems wrong, first check your bet receipt to confirm the boost was active. Then, review the specific boost terms for any maximum win limits that may have capped your extra winnings.
  • Boost unavailable for account: Some promotions are targeted. Check the promotions section of your account to see if you are eligible. It may not be available to all players or in all regions.

If problems persist, contacting Hadesbet customer support with details of your bet slip ID is the best course of action.

Strategic Advice for Maximizing the Acca Boost

To get the most value from the Hadesbet accumulator bet boost, a strategic approach is better than simply adding random selections. Firstly, focus on quality over quantity. Adding a sixth selection with very low odds just to meet a threshold might not be as valuable as a well-researched 3-leg acca with solid odds. The boost multiplies your existing odds, so starting with strong, informed picks is key. Secondly, use it as part of a broader bankroll management strategy. Since accumulators are inherently risky, never stake a significant portion of your funds on a single acca, even with a boost. Treat it as a tool for potentially higher returns on bets you were already planning to place, rather than the primary reason for placing a bet.
